Output 63c5a66d57ef9153c94d719c2b517e19ba535883a13e3eea8dd79eb1b79f8460:0

value
68595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ca290acd2751786a75a1670e9f358d3812a3f5f0 OP_EQUAL
address
3L7waxM493EqhLxa7EKjT1Quo7KNvWnsBR
transaction
63c5a66d57ef9153c94d719c2b517e19ba535883a13e3eea8dd79eb1b79f8460